[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#517795: glibc wants to restart xscreensaver, which has no init script



Steve Langasek a écrit :
> On Sun, Mar 01, 2009 at 07:36:26PM -0800, Steve Langasek wrote:
>> Package: libc6
>> Version: 2.9-3
>> Severity: normal
> 
>> After acknowledging the latest glibc upgrade, libc6 spits out a warning
>> message:
> 
>>  Preparing to replace libc6 2.7-18 (using .../g/glibc/libc6_2.9-3_i386.deb) ...
>>  Checking for services that may need to be restarted...
>>  Checking init scripts...
>>  WARNING: init script for xscreensaver not found.
>>  Unpacking replacement libc6 ...
> 
> The entertaining flip-side to this bug is that receipt of my own bug report
> mail was delayed for 5 hours, because after upgrading glibc, postfix smtpd
> started segfaulting.
> 
>   Mar  2 00:05:00 minbar kernel: [31907.000813] smtpd[22263]: segfault at d89c0 ip 000d89c0 sp bfa26100 error 4 in libcrypt-2.9.so[b7801000+9000]
> 
> Restarting postfix with the init script was enough to resolve this.
> 
> So I wonder if the libc6.preinst has been pruned too aggressively...

Yeah, version 2.9-3 is buggy, the version triggering the restart of
services has only been bumped in the preinst, not the postinst.

This should be fixed in version 2.9-4.

-- 
Aurelien Jarno	                        GPG: 1024D/F1BCDB73
aurelien@aurel32.net                 http://www.aurel32.net



Reply to: